Georg Jensen, Caravel, dinner fork in sterling silver. 1960s

About the Item

Georg Jensen, Caravel, a dinner fork in sterling silver. Modernist and sleek design. Designed by Henning Koppel. From the 1960s. Stamped with the hallmark used after 1944. In excellent condition. Dimensions: 18.9 cm.
